From Fedora Project Wiki
No edit summary |
|||
Line 1: | Line 1: | ||
'''''Javi Roman:''''' [https://twitter.com/javiromanrh Twitter] [http://es.linkedin.com/in/javiroman Linkedin] [http://www.viewbug.com/member/javiroman Photography] | '''''Javi Roman:''''' [https://twitter.com/javiromanrh Twitter] [http://es.linkedin.com/in/javiroman Linkedin] [http://www.viewbug.com/member/javiroman Photography] | ||
= Fedora Big Data Package Ecosystem = | |||
{| class="wikitable" style="color:black; background-color:#CCFFFF;" cellpadding="10" | |||
! Package !! Bugzilla !! Status | |||
|- | |||
|Apache Hadoop | |||
|<s>{{bz|976049}}</s> | |||
|Package is available in Rawhide and in Fedora 21 as an update | |||
|- | |||
|Apache HBase | |||
|<s>{{bz|1178861}}</s> | |||
|Package is available in Rawhide and in Fedora 21 as an update | |||
|- | |||
|Apache Hive | |||
|No BZ ticket | |||
|No added for revision in Bugzilla | |||
|- | |||
Apache Pig | |||
|No BZ ticket | |||
|aynchbase dependency. No added for revision in Bugzilla | |||
|- | |||
|Apache Zookeeper | |||
|{{bz|1179355}} | |||
|Patched in order to support Fedora Guava version (partial support). | |||
|- | |||
|Apache Oozie | |||
|<s>{{bz|1073017}}</s> | |||
|kite package dependency. Package is available in Rawhide and was submitted to Fedora 22 and 21 as an update | |||
|- | |||
|Apache Ambari | |||
|<s>{{bz|1073014}}</s> | |||
|parquet package dependency. Package is available in Rawhide and was submitted to Fedora 22 and 21 as an update | |||
|- | |||
|maxmind-db-java | |||
|<s>{{bz|1179309}}</s> | |||
|kite package dependency. Package is available in Rawhide and in Fedora 21 as an update | |||
|- | |||
|ua-parser-java | |||
|<s>{{bz|1179342}}</s> | |||
|kite package dependency. Package is available in Rawhide and in Fedora 21 as an update | |||
|- | |||
|elasticsearch | |||
|<s>{{bz|902086}} {{bz|1181564}}</s> | |||
|Package is available in Rawhide and in Fedora 22 as an update | |||
|} | |||
= Apache Flume package status = | = Apache Flume package status = |
Revision as of 08:40, 12 May 2015
Javi Roman: Twitter Linkedin Photography
Fedora Big Data Package Ecosystem
Apache PigPackage | Bugzilla | Status |
---|---|---|
Apache Hadoop | Package is available in Rawhide and in Fedora 21 as an update | |
Apache HBase | Package is available in Rawhide and in Fedora 21 as an update | |
Apache Hive | No BZ ticket | No added for revision in Bugzilla |
No BZ ticket | aynchbase dependency. No added for revision in Bugzilla | |
Apache Zookeeper | RHBZ #1179355 | Patched in order to support Fedora Guava version (partial support). |
Apache Oozie | kite package dependency. Package is available in Rawhide and was submitted to Fedora 22 and 21 as an update | |
Apache Ambari | parquet package dependency. Package is available in Rawhide and was submitted to Fedora 22 and 21 as an update | |
maxmind-db-java | kite package dependency. Package is available in Rawhide and in Fedora 21 as an update | |
ua-parser-java | kite package dependency. Package is available in Rawhide and in Fedora 21 as an update | |
elasticsearch | Package is available in Rawhide and in Fedora 22 as an update |
Apache Flume package status
Package status
The package builds with this assumptions (we are working on this issues)
- The code is not ready for Thrift v0.9.1 available in Fedora 21, however Flume code can builds using legacy Thrift built-in code available in the upstream Flume TGZ.
- Disable ElasticSearch Sink
- Disable Morphline Solr Sink
- Disable Twitter Source
- Disable Kite Dataset Sink
Testing the package
git clone https://github.com/fedora-bigdata-rpms/flume-rpm.git cd flume-rpm spectool -g flume.spec rpmbuild -bs --nodeps --define "_sourcedir ." --define "_srcrpmdir ." flume.spec sudo mock flume-1.5.2-1.fc21.src.rpm
Dependency packages
- In order to build Flume with full features those are the dependency packages and their status:
Package | Bugzilla | Status |
---|---|---|
irclib | Package is available in Rawhide and in Fedora 21 as an update | |
mapdb | Package is available in Rawhide and in Fedora 21 as an update | |
asynchbase | No BZ ticket | No added for revision in Bugzilla |
suasync | No BZ ticket | aynchbase dependency. No added for revision in Bugzilla |
kite | RHBZ #1179355 | Patched in order to support Fedora Guava version (partial support). |
parquet | kite package dependency. Package is available in Rawhide and was submitted to Fedora 22 and 21 as an update | |
parquet-format | parquet package dependency. Package is available in Rawhide and was submitted to Fedora 22 and 21 as an update | |
maxmind-db-java | kite package dependency. Package is available in Rawhide and in Fedora 21 as an update | |
ua-parser-java | kite package dependency. Package is available in Rawhide and in Fedora 21 as an update | |
elasticsearch | Package is available in Rawhide and in Fedora 22 as an update |